Reviews

Social Stream

Social Stream consolidates live social messaging streams, allowing users to customize and control their feeds. It's ideal for social media managers and content creators who need real-time monitoring across multiple platforms.

Consolidates and customizes live social messaging streams.

Pros

  • + Consolidates multiple social messaging streams into one place
  • + Customizable feeds for tailored content
  • + Active development with frequent updates

Cons

  • - No auto-update feature
  • - Low install count indicating limited user adoption

OBS

OBS is a versatile, open-source tool for live streaming and screen recording, offering extensive customization and plugin support. It's ideal for content creators, gamers, and developers seeking a free, flexible solution for video production.

Enables live streaming and screen recording with customizable settings and third-party plugins.

Pros

  • + Open-source with active community support
  • + Highly customizable with plugin ecosystem
  • + Free and widely adopted across multiple platforms

Cons

  • - Steep learning curve for new users
  • - Occasional bugs due to its complexity
